I should also mention that GIMP is available for Windows, Linux, and Mac. It works very well in Windows. We put it on all of our Windows images. GIMP can read and write Photoshop files. Here is a little anecdote about GIMP. In May, we had a high school senior who was working on her final project for her art class. It was a Photoshop assignment that required he to create an image with several layers and filters using Photoshop. She had saved her project - as a Photoshop .psd file - on her USB drive. The next day, she went to art class and the file would not open. She came to the tech office with her USB drive. I placed her USB drive in my laptop, opened her "corrupted" Photoshop file - that Photoshop would not open - with GIMP, saved it as a .psd file, returned to the art classroom and opened the file in Photoshop. A few minutes later, two more students showed up at the tech room door with files for me to "recover".

GIMP rocks!!!!!!
